In a medium bowl, whisk eggs, salt, and pepper until completely combined. place in the microwave, and cook for 3 minutes or until eggs have reached desired doneness. remove from …May 31, 2020 · How To Freeze Breakfast Burritos.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Place burritos on the sheet, seam side down. Press down on the burritos again lightly making sure that the edges are tucked in. Place baking sheet in the freezer for an hour to flash freeze the burritos. Remove from freezer and wrap burritos in plastic wrap individually. Air fry at 350F for 6-10 minutes, or until the burritos are crispy and golden brown; Reheat in a toaster oven for 7-8 minutes (depending on your toaster oven); Toast for 4-5 minutes to get the outside crispy, then microwave for 30-45 more seconds to ensure it’s heated through.In a medium bowl, whisk the eggs with the smoked paprika and salt. Continue to cook, …Microwave – for a thawed burrito, microwave on high for about 1 minute. For a frozen burrito, wrap in a damp paper towel and microwave on high for about 2 minutes, turning halfway through. Oven – for thawed burritos, bake in a preheated 400°F oven for about 15 minutes.
